Understanding Stem Cell Therapy Costs: A Comprehensive Guide

Navigating the complex landscape of stem cell therapy can be challenging, particularly when it comes to understanding the associated costs. This comprehensive guide aims to shed light on the diverse factors that influence stem cell therapy expenses and provide you with the knowledge needed to make wise financial decisions.

The cost of stem cell therapy fluctuates significantly based on a variety of elements. Among the type of stem cells used, the disease being treated, the complexity of read more the case, the site of the treatment center, and the length of the therapy regimen.

Furthermore, costs may include initial evaluations, laboratory procedures, stem cell extraction, administration fees, post-treatment monitoring, and potential recovery expenses.

It's essential to speak with your physician to obtain a personalized cost estimate based on your particular circumstances. They can provide you with a comprehensive breakdown of the projected expenses and explore any payment options that may be available to you.
